One of my long time friends has an 2007 Z06 which I have been privileged to drive on several occasions. That thing is a beast in the power and handling department. Its in the supercar class or ought to be. 505 NA Hp stock from a 7L V8 into a 6 speed trans-axle. Big Brakes, Goodyear F1 tires. Driver selectable active suspension. HUD (heads up display) instrumentation and driver selectable on the fly engine tunes. 0-60 in 1st gear and 2nd takes it to 100. Its not for drag racing but get it out to run and most private airplanes won't keep up. Its basically a street legal race car. Would I trade my S197 for it. You bet. But you didn't say what year your proposed Z06 trade was from. To the Mustang's credit it didn't cost me 80K to buy it. Has a decent amount of cargo space and a back seat. And is surprisingly a more comfortable car to drive.

if you think the C4 is bad, the C3 is worse, my first car was a '74 corvette, those cars needed to be thrown away once they hit 100k miles. the rearends could not hold the power and are very expensive to rebuild. the interior parts were junk, the problem with those cars is alot of the issues were ones that there wasn't a real fix for
